Temri Population - Durg, Chhattisgarh

Temri is a large village located in Nawagarh Tehsil of Durg district, Chhattisgarh with total 815 families residing. The Temri village has population of 3770 of which 1874 are males while 1896 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Temri village population of children with age 0-6 is 617 which makes up 16.37 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Temri village is 1012 which is higher than Chhattisgarh state average of 991. Child Sex Ratio for the Temri as per census is 1030, higher than Chhattisgarh average of 969.

Temri village has lower literacy rate compared to Chhattisgarh. In 2011, literacy rate of Temri village was 70.25 % compared to 70.28 % of Chhattisgarh. In Temri Male literacy stands at 82.80 % while female literacy rate was 57.80 %.

Temri Data

Particulars Total Male Female
Total No. of Houses 815 - -
Population 3,770 1,874 1,896
Child (0-6) 617 304 313
Schedule Caste 1,287 644 643
Schedule Tribe 43 26 17
Literacy 70.25 % 82.80 % 57.80 %
Total Workers 1,927 994 933
Main Worker 1,184 - -
Marginal Worker 743 279 464

Caste Factor

Temri village of Durg has substantial population of Schedule Caste.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 34.14 % while Schedule Tribe (ST) were 1.14 % of total population in Temri village.

Work Profile

In Temri village out of total population, 1927 were engaged in work activities. 61.44 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 38.56 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 1927 workers engaged in Main Work, 397 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 582 were Agricultural labourer.
